Super special sandwich
Jose A.

I went to this small Persian sandwich shop in North Vancouver before heading up to Whistler and Squamish for the weekend. We stopped by quite hungry and wanted something different, so we entered into this small mom-and-pop joint and as a result, I was quite surprised by what we ordered. I personally got the super special sandwich. It includes hotdog, beef and chicken slices with the bread being so thin but still manageable in your hand - I felt like a majority of the sandwich was all of the stuffing like the grilled vegetables, the sauces, and the meat that made the sandwich so tasty. By the end of it, I didn't feel like I was eating a ton of carbs, and every once in a while, a sandwich like this one here will definitely leave a good, lasting effect on you. The overall restaurant was quite clean inside; it was quite sanitary. They had some bathrooms that you could use. Another thing that I also tried was some Persian fruit soda. It was again quite good. I ordered a fruit medley one, and it paired up well with a sandwich, although greasy, it paired up well. Would I return to this place? Yes, I would. I would definitely go here if I am heading up to Whistler for the weekend and wanted to stop for a quick sit-down lunch. Although you could take this for takeout, I wouldn't because of the mess and grease that ensues.

Ambiance and Decor I visited this café and sandwich shop on…read morea Friday afternoon during the lunch rush. It's a small, homey place with simple décor. The lighting isn't the best, as the staff mostly rely on the large entrance window for natural light. Service Quality The staff was kind and friendly. They are more than happy to help you choose a sandwich if it's your first time. You really can't go wrong with anything on the menu. Menu Variety Their sandwich selection is excellent, and the bread is particularly noteworthy. They also offer a couple of iced tea options, which is a nice alternative to water. Food Presentation If you're dining in, your sandwich will be served in a plastic basket lined with wax paper. For takeout, it's wrapped in the same wax paper. Food Taste and Quality I ordered the Spicy Italian, which had just the right amount of heat. It was generously loaded with greens, and the multigrain bread was fresh, likely baked that morning. Portion Sizes The portions are substantial. I was only able to finish half of my sandwich for lunch. Price and Value The sandwich cost about $15, which is on the pricier side. It would have been nice to see it priced around $12. Overall Experience and Recommendation If you're in the area or heading to Horseshoe Bay to catch a ferry, definitely stop by S'wich for a sandwich. I will definitely be returning to try other options on the menu.

Inflation does not exist in one of the few places of the world here at Burgoo. The food is top…read morequality with great ingredients at a price that cannot be beat anywhere else. Make sure you try the lobster bisque as it's one of the meatiest I've had to date; full of that shellfish flavour. The French onion soup is an eye catcher but the broth could use a bit more richness and flavour. Beef bourignon was suggested and I'm glad I took the friendly waitress' recommendation as it was a warm hug on a deep plate. I'd opt to swap for roasted potatoes instead of the mash but the mash does soak up all that delicious stew. The jambalaya is full of different proteins and if you're a fan of that, then I'd make sure to eat this perfectly cooked rice dish. I finished off with a banana bread pudding which was exactly that, banana bread in that bread pudding form; Personally I was hoping for bread pudding that was banana flavoured but it was still ooey gooey goodness. Burgoo should be packed to the brim with this menu for these prices and the friendliness of the staff!
